Lamentations 4
- 1
- How is the gold become dim! how is the most fine gold changed! the stones of the sanctuary are poured out in the top of every street.
- 2
- The precious sons of Zion, comparable to fine gold, how are they esteemed as earthen pitchers, the work of the hands of the potter!
- 3
- Even the sea monsters draw out the breast, they give suck to their young ones: the daughter of my people is become cruel, like the ostriches in the wilderness.
- 4
- The tongue of the sucking child cleaveth to the roof of his mouth for thirst: the young children ask bread, and no man breaketh it unto them.
- 5
- They that did feed delicately are desolate in the streets: they that were brought up in scarlet embrace dunghills.
- 6
- For the punishment of the iniquity of the daughter of my people is greater than the punishment of the sin of Sodom, that was overthrown as in a moment, and no hands stayed on her.
- 7
- Her Nazarites were purer than snow, they were whiter than milk, they were more ruddy in body than rubies, their polishing was of sapphire:
- 8
- Their visage is blacker than a coal; they are not known in the streets: their skin cleaveth to their bones; it is withered, it is become like a stick.
- 9
- They that be slain with the sword are better than they that be slain with hunger: for these pine away, stricken through for want of the fruits of the field.
- 10
- The hands of the pitiful women have sodden their own children: they were their meat in the destruction of the daughter of my people.
- 11
- The LORD hath accomplished his fury; he hath poured out his fierce anger, and hath kindled a fire in Zion, and it hath devoured the foundations thereof.
- 12
- The kings of the earth, and all the inhabitants of the world, would not have believed that the adversary and the enemy should have entered into the gates of Jerusalem.
- 13
- For the sins of her prophets, and the iniquities of her priests, that have shed the blood of the just in the midst of her,
- 14
- They have wandered as blind men in the streets, they have polluted themselves with blood, so that men could not touch their garments.
- 15
- They cried unto them, Depart ye; it is unclean; depart, depart, touch not: when they fled away and wandered, they said among the heathen, They shall no more sojourn there.
- 16
- The anger of the LORD hath divided them; he will no more regard them: they respected not the persons of the priests, they favoured not the elders.
- 17
- As for us, our eyes as yet failed for our vain help: in our watching we have watched for a nation that could not save us.
- 18
- They hunt our steps, that we cannot go in our streets: our end is near, our days are fulfilled; for our end is come.
- 19
- Our persecutors are swifter than the eagles of the heaven: they pursued us upon the mountains, they laid wait for us in the wilderness.
- 20
- The breath of our nostrils, the anointed of the LORD, was taken in their pits, of whom we said, Under his shadow we shall live among the heathen.
- 21
- Rejoice and be glad, O daughter of Edom, that dwellest in the land of Uz; the cup also shall pass through unto thee: thou shalt be drunken, and shalt make thyself naked.
- 22
- The punishment of thine iniquity is accomplished, O daughter of Zion; he will no more carry thee away into captivity: he will visit thine iniquity, O daughter of Edom; he will discover thy sins.
Lamentations 5
- 1
- Remember, O LORD, what is come upon us: consider, and behold our reproach.
- 2
- Our inheritance is turned to strangers, our houses to aliens.
- 3
- We are orphans and fatherless, our mothers are as widows.
- 4
- We have drunken our water for money; our wood is sold unto us.
- 5
- Our necks are under persecution: we labour, and have no rest.
- 6
- We have given the hand to the Egyptians, and to the Assyrians, to be satisfied with bread.
- 7
- Our fathers have sinned, and are not; and we have borne their iniquities.
- 8
- Servants have ruled over us: there is none that doth deliver us out of their hand.
- 9
- We gat our bread with the peril of our lives because of the sword of the wilderness.
- 10
- Our skin was black like an oven because of the terrible famine.
- 11
- They ravished the women in Zion, and the maids in the cities of Judah.
- 12
- Princes are hanged up by their hand: the faces of elders were not honoured.
- 13
- They took the young men to grind, and the children fell under the wood.
- 14
- The elders have ceased from the gate, the young men from their musick.
- 15
- The joy of our heart is ceased; our dance is turned into mourning.
- 16
- The crown is fallen from our head: woe unto us, that we have sinned!
- 17
- For this our heart is faint; for these things our eyes are dim.
- 18
- Because of the mountain of Zion, which is desolate, the foxes walk upon it.
- 19
- Thou, O LORD, remainest for ever; thy throne from generation to generation.
- 20
- Wherefore dost thou forget us for ever, and forsake us so long time?
- 21
- Turn thou us unto thee, O LORD, and we shall be turned; renew our days as of old.
- 22
- But thou hast utterly rejected us; thou art very wroth against us.
